Mechanical Engineer Resume Summary Example

A strong professional summary immediately positions you for the role. Here's a high-performing example you can adapt:

"Mechanical Engineer with 6 years in product development and manufacturing for automotive and aerospace industries. Designed components reducing assembly time by 25% and material cost by 18%. PE-licensed with expertise in SolidWorks, FEA simulation, and DFM. Led cross-functional team of 8 through full product lifecycle."

Recruiter-Approved Tips for Your Mechanical Engineer Resume

Based on feedback from hiring managers at top companies:

  • Include PE license or EIT certification
  • Show cost savings or performance improvements
  • Mention industries: aerospace, auto, medical, consumer
  • List specific CAD/FEA tools and versions

Frequently Asked Questions

What should a Mechanical Engineer resume include? +
A strong mechanical engineer resume should include a concise professional summary, quantified work experience, relevant technical skills (especially SolidWorks, AutoCAD, CATIA), education, and certifications. Use bullet points starting with action verbs and always tailor it to each job description using keywords from the posting.
How long should a Mechanical Engineer resume be? +
For most mechanical engineers with under 10 years of experience, one page is ideal. Senior professionals with extensive project portfolios can use two pages. Never exceed two pages — recruiters typically spend 6-8 seconds on the first pass.
What's the best resume format for a Mechanical Engineer? +
